%0 Artículo revista %A Sánchez, Jaime %I Centro de Investigaciones de la Facultad de Filosofía y Humanidades %D 2022 %G Español %T El Cristo de Espaldas: perspectives of nomadic hermeneutics to grasp the Colombian violence from a literature standpoint %U https://revistas.unc.edu.ar/index.php/recial/article/view/37544 %X It’s been five years since the signing of the peace dialogues in Colombia and behind it, we still have a society that appears to be immersed in death.      Eduardo Caballero Calderon’s work yet to be explored (1910-1993), knew well how to depict that peasant and bipartisan violence which early on portrayed the fate that would accompany the Colombian nation during seven decades. Starting from a hermeneutical diapason, which aims to look back at the past and confront the present, the importance of regional and classic literature is noticed, one which explores everyday life and sheds light in order to understand the present cycles. Rescuing from the work El cristo de espaldas the forms of violence and how the discourses of uprooting and ideological and social exclusion, are transformed into a direct denunciation to a legacy that has not been overcome. By way of the present reflective exercise, there appears a claim to the pending claim for the task of consolidating a nation, especially from the standpoint of the participative citizenry, who, based on their reality should lay bridges with its history, culture, and literature in order to grasp and signify its present and this way renounce the weight of that split mentality.
